CFX 12.0 has got a streamline curvature correction model. Also, it provides few parameteric tuning into it, such as CSCALE. When to use this model ? and what shall be the range of values for CSALE ? Would be greatfull if someone tells about why its to be used ..

It is to correct turbulence generation in strongly swirling flows. Don't fiddle with the constants unless you REALLY know what you are doing, and certainly not before reading the literature about what the constants mean.

Quote:
The CFX Solver theory guide do not talk about any guidance on it.
As I said, there should be a literature reference for the model in the documentation. You won't get anywhere until you follow that up. Do not fiddle with the constants until you know what they mean.

Whether you need the curvature correction model or not is up to you. Run with it and without it and see if it makes a difference to your models. Also keep in mind that other turbulence models may be more appropriate such as RSM or LES. 2-equation turbulence models are well known to have problems with strongly swirling flows.
